
Suggest Best Method To Terminate Pregnancy

My wife delivered a baby 10 months back through a c section and now she is pregnant again and does not wish to continue the pregnancy what would be the safest method of terminating the pregnancy her last cycle was around 5 weeks ago and will it affect her since she had a c section surgery
medical abortion under close supervision
Detailed Answer:
Hello sir, thanks for trusting health care magic.
As she has early pregnancy the best method for termination will be by medicines. The medicines routinely used are Misoprostol and mifepristone. Discuss with her treating doctor about the same.
But as she has had a cesarean section she should first get herself examined from a gynecologist for size of uterus and termination has to be under the supervision of a doctor because cesarean scar can rarely rupture during the process of expulsion.
Don't panic listening to this but one should be aware of possible side effects of everything.
And after termination of pregnancy adopt a regular contraception because repeated abortions in a patient of previous cesarean is a risky procedure.

abortion process can be little painful
Detailed Answer:
Hello sir, the abortion medicines cause the dislodgement of implanted baby by increasing uterine contractions and then expelling the same.
It hurts a little but ever since her pregnancy is an early one it is not going to be an unbearable pain.
In case it still hurts then you can take the medicines prescribed by your doctor and she will feel better in minutes.

2-8 hours usually, mild weakness can persist.
Detailed Answer:
It will take around 2-4 hours in a normal case and once she expells the tissue it will be done and then just simple menstrual type bleeding will set in.
As she has had a cesarean before she can take a little longer time to expel.
She can feel a little weak for a few days and nothing much thereafter.
